WATERWAY, TO SING THE SPACE
Orel Tomáš, Jakub ; Šejn, Miloš (referee) ; Helia De Felice, Jennifer (advisor)
The way of the Jedovnice creek: connection with the spring Falling into the underground halls and back to the light. The Water Way is an intermedial poem that is concerned to the element of water, character of its way through the landscape and its presence in the landscape. Since the type of work I most prefer is the work in the landscape, I am returning back to the natural landscape, strong places in Moravian karst near Brno. The audiovisual poem is primarily focused on the moment of melting. Sublimation of ice from the ice shelter, ephemeral phenomena on the surface, such as miniature whirls, waves, rays of sunlight and especially moonlight. The poem focuses on the possibilities of transferring the experience with a specific place, and the events in a unique, unrepeatable time and space into the theatrical scene and possibilities of the musical and audiovisual interpretation of such experience. I work with digital media (video mix and audiostop) to transfer the artist's physical experience in a unique time and unique natural setting into the scenic form of the work. Considering the physical and symbolic qualities of the water element, I have abandoned the composition of the event in the classical sense.
The study navigable Odra in the Ostrava - state boundary with Poland
Halaška, Ondřej ; Vrba, Jan (referee) ; Veselý, Jaroslav (advisor)
This bachelor's thesis deals with the problem of navigability of the Odra River from Ostrava to the Polish state border. The development of the European waterway transport together with the current condition of Czech waterways is described and a comparison of water, road and railway cargo transport is made. The next parts of the thesis deal with the historical development of Odra waterways, its route and transport capacity. The last part of the thesis is devoted to hydrological and bed-load ratio of the Odra River, after realization navigability.
Editing a selected section of watercourse
Tomšej, Lukáš ; Olišarová, Lucie (referee) ; Šlezingr, Miloslav (advisor)
This bachelor thesis deals with the modification of the section of the Baťa Canal in the town of Strážnice, namely in the range of 8,300 km to 9,520 km. The alteration is divided into two implementation phases. In the first one, all the sediments will be extracted from the bottom of the canal, which will be subsequently dewatered and plowed into the farmland. The removal of the sediments from the canal bed will be made on the original bottom level stated by the handling and operating rules for the sailing route Otrokovice – Rohatec. In the second implementation phase, adequate bank and accompanying growth will be designed, which are an integral part of stabilization adjustments. Due to historical value of the water canal, a major change in the profile of the canal bed cannot be made. Keeping this in mind, biotechnical stabilization of slopes will be carried out. The aim of the regulation is primarily to increase the capacity of the Baťa Canal for the needs of cruise. Also the planting of new trees will restores vegetation accompaniment.
Study of extension of Bata canal waterway in Rohatec
Gulec, Jakub ; Duchan, David (referee) ; Dráb, Aleš (advisor)
The bachelor's thesis deals with navigating the last section of the Baťa canal in the section between the Rohatec weir and the Hodonín weir. The first part of the thesis describes the current state of the site of interest with its evaluation. The following sections describe the necessary building modifications. An integral parts of the thesis are drawings of the proposed solution of navigating this section of the waterway, hydrotechnical calculations and photo documentation from the site exploration.

Vliv lodní dopravy na Baťův kanál
Firešová, Martina
This diploma thesis is focused on ascertaining the state of the Baťa canal in connection with shipping. In the beginning of the thesis, the issue of shipping in the Czech Republic, the history of the Baťa canal and the construction on it, the issue of water and its protection is discussed. The impact of the modern phenomenon in tourism in the form of renting vessels and their effect on water quality and ecosystems in the vicinity of the waterway is primarily addressed. Based on the collected data, no negative effect was observed. The work also monitors the behavior of visitors to this historic waterway and its surroundings, assessed on the basis of a questionnaire and a field investigation, where the negative attitude of the tourism industry was not proven. The topic under discussion is the preservation of the current favorable situation on the Baťa canal. By introducing a suitable measure, for example in the form of a regulated number of tourists on the canal, the environmental impact on this waterway could also have a positive effect.
